  • Outdoor Adventures for Year 4!

    Published 04/07/25

    On Monday 30th June to Tuesday 1st July, our Year 4 children took part in an exciting residential! Fenland Adventure brought the school field to life with lots of adventurous activities, including go-cart building, archery, climbing and many more. The children also slept overnight on the school field in bell-tents and had an absolutely amazing time. This was the first residential we have offered for Year 4 and will definitely become a permanent feature in our trips and visits plan - we have already booked for next year!

  • A Bramble Patch Adventure!

    Published 25/06/25

    Yesterday, the Buttercross children visited The Bramble Patch, linked with our ‘Once upon a time’ topic: we had an amazing day filled with activities!

    The children helped the Little Red Hen bake some bread, built a bridge for the Three Billy Goats Gruff and found Cinderella's lost slipper using maps, compasses and reading directions!

  • Outstandingly Happy School Award

    Published 20/06/25

    Yesterday, some of our Year 5 children ended the Super SOKE Celebration at Wittering Primary School. This event was led by Will Hussey from the Art of Brilliance and was an opportunity for children from our Trust schools to come together. Each school shared what makes their school utterly brilliant and the children had lots of opportunities to meet each other. At the end of the session, we were awarded with the ‘Outstandingly Happy School’ banner, which is proudly displayed on our playground.

  • A 'Wicked' visit!

    Published 23/05/25

    Today, KS2 have been visited by Ennio's mum, Mrs Tomeo. Mrs Tomeo works in theatre and film make-up and worked in the stage production and film production of 'Wicked the Musical'. She brought in some of the masks used in the show and the make-up used to paint Elpheba. She spoke to the children about her role and the children had many questions for her! We are so fortunate to have had this experience ahead of our trip to see Wicked after half-term. Thank you so much, Mrs Tomeo!
